Framer Developer (Business & Tech?Focused Web Design)

We’re looking for a Framer?savvy front?end developer to join our fast?scaling tech team on an hourly, ongoing basis. You’ll own the translation of Figma concepts and existing Framer templates into polished, high?impact web experiences—iterating rapidly, integrating new components, and collaborating closely with marketing, product, and design stakeholders.
--> What You’ll Do
- Evolve & Extend Templates: Rapidly update, personalize, and add new features to existing Framer templates—no reinventing the wheel, but elevating what’s already in place.
- Build Custom Components: Create or modify code components (HTML/CSS/JS) in Framer to support animations, interactive modules, and dynamic layouts.
- Translate Designs Faithfully: Turn Figma files or wireframes into responsive, accessible, SEO?optimized pages that load fast and look pixel?perfect.
- Iterate at Pace: Work on hourly sprints, incorporate feedback loops, and push updates multiple times per week—flexibility and speed are key.
- Collaborate Deeply: Engage asynchronously with cross?functional teams—product managers, brand designers, marketers—to maintain design system consistency and brand alignment.
- Optimize & Measure: Ensure pages meet performance, accessibility, and conversion benchmarks; partner with analytics/CRO leads on A/B tests and data?driven refinements.

What We’re Looking For
---> 3–5+ years of front?end/web development experience, with strong Framer expertise (including code components).
Proficiency in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and comfort writing and debugging within Framer’s code editor.
---> Deep understanding of responsive design, modern UI patterns, and web performance best practices.
---> Experience working hourly in fast?paced, remote?first, asynchronous teams—flexible schedule, quick turnaround.
---> Demonstrated ability to personalize and extend third?party templates, thrive on iterative design, and handle frequent feedback loops without tortoise?pace delays.
---> Solid communication skills: you keep tickets updated, clarify requirements up front, and ask questions early.

Nice?to?Haves
- Background in B2B/SaaS or tech/fintech websites.
- Familiarity with CRO principles, A/B testing frameworks, or analytics tooling.
- Experience with CMS integrations (e.g., headless CMS) or scalable component libraries.
- A portfolio showcasing dynamic Framer projects—from landing pages to product microsites—where you’ve driven measurable engagement or conversion lifts.
